On the Bootlegger mod I built for the wife, I've had her charging the 18650's via USB overnight because it lasts her the whole day under normal vaping. But if she forgets to hook it up or happens to vape more than normal, the batteries are easily swapped out. And I did up the cutoff to 3.2v as well. I kept an eye on it the first night and it charges the 18650's same as the lipo... tapers and stops at max capacity, 4.20v for each cell. She's also vaped while the USB is plugged in without any issues.
